终极Wiseflow代码质量检测指南:10个提升代码规范性的自动化技巧

终极Wiseflow代码质量检测指南:10个提升代码规范性的自动化技巧

【免费下载链接】wiseflow Wiseflow is an agile information mining tool that extracts concise messages from various sources such as websites, WeChat official accounts, social platforms, etc. It automatically categorizes and uploads them to the database. 【免费下载链接】wiseflow 项目地址: https://gitcode.com/gh_mirrors/wi/wiseflow

Wiseflow是一个强大的敏捷信息挖掘工具,它能够从各类网络信源中智能提取并分类关键信息。作为一个AI驱动的自动化工具,Wiseflow不仅能够帮助用户监控和追踪信息,还能通过其独特的代码分析功能提升项目的整体代码质量。🚀

在当今快速发展的软件开发环境中,代码质量直接关系到项目的可维护性和扩展性。Wiseflow通过其创新的静态代码分析功能,为开发者提供了全方位的代码质量保障。

🔍 Wiseflow代码检测的核心优势

Wiseflow的代码质量检测功能基于先进的LLM技术,能够深入分析代码结构、识别潜在问题,并提供智能化的改进建议。

🎯 智能代码解析能力

Wiseflow内置的HTML智能解析机制可以自动识别代码中的关键信息与可延伸探索的链接。通过crawl4ai_types.py模块,它能够理解复杂的代码结构,并从中提取有价值的信息。

代码质量分析

⚡ 自动化检测流程

Wiseflow通过async_webcrawler.py实现高效的代码扫描,自动发现代码中的不规范写法、潜在错误和安全漏洞。

📋 快速配置代码检测环境

1. 安装依赖环境

curl -LsSf https://astral.sh/uv/install.sh | sh
git clone https://gitcode.com/gh_mirrors/wi/wiseflow

2. 配置检测参数

在.env文件中配置以下关键参数:

  • LLM_API_KEY:您的模型服务密钥
  • PRIMARY_MODEL:主分析模型配置
  • CONCURRENT_NUMBER:并发检测数量

🔧 10个提升代码质量的实用技巧

1️⃣ 自动化代码规范检查

Wiseflow能够自动检测代码中的命名规范、注释质量、函数复杂度等问题。通过general_process.py模块,它可以对代码进行深度分析。

2️⃣ 智能错误识别

利用extraction_strategy.py中的策略模式,Wiseflow能够识别各种类型的代码错误。

信息提取流程

3️⃣ 实时性能监控

Wiseflow通过async_dispatcher.py实现多任务并发处理,确保代码检测的高效性。

4️⃣ 自定义检测规则

通过customer_config.py模块,用户可以定制个性化的代码检测标准。

5️⃣ 智能重构建议

基于chunking_strategy.py中的分块策略,Wiseflow能够提供精准的代码重构方案。

🚀 高级代码质量优化策略

🎯 深度学习代码分析

Wiseflow的deep_clear.py模块采用先进的深度学习技术,能够理解代码的语义含义。

⚡ 持续集成支持

Wiseflow可以无缝集成到CI/CD流程中,通过docker_entrypoint.sh支持容器化部署。

🔍 多维度代码评估

通过insight目录下的分析工具,Wiseflow能够从多个维度评估代码质量。

📊 检测结果可视化

Wiseflow提供详细的检测报告,通过export_infos.py模块,用户可以直观地了解代码质量状况。

搜索源选择

💡 最佳实践建议

1. 定期执行代码检测

建议每周至少执行一次全面的代码质量检测,及时发现并修复问题。

2. 定制检测标准

根据项目特点,在config目录下配置适合的检测规则。

3. 结合团队开发流程

将Wiseflow代码检测集成到团队的日常开发流程中。

🌟 总结

Wiseflow的静态代码分析功能为开发者提供了强大的代码质量保障工具。通过自动化的检测流程、智能化的分析算法和可视化的结果展示,Wiseflow让代码质量检测变得简单高效。无论是个人项目还是团队开发,Wiseflow都能帮助您持续提升代码质量,确保项目的长期健康发展。

通过这10个实用的代码质量提升技巧,结合Wiseflow的强大功能,您将能够构建出更加健壮、可维护的软件系统。🚀

【免费下载链接】wiseflow Wiseflow is an agile information mining tool that extracts concise messages from various sources such as websites, WeChat official accounts, social platforms, etc. It automatically categorizes and uploads them to the database. 【免费下载链接】wiseflow 项目地址: https://gitcode.com/gh_mirrors/wi/wiseflow

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值